Benefits of Weatherproof Resin for UK Outdoor Spaces
Weatherproof resin systems deliver exceptional performance in British conditions through their advanced polymer composition. These materials resist water penetration, preventing the freeze-thaw damage that commonly affects concrete and natural stone surfaces. The seamless nature of resin installations eliminates joints where water can accumulate, reducing maintenance requirements and extending surface lifespan. Additionally, resin surfaces maintain their slip resistance even when wet, addressing safety concerns during frequent rainfall periods.
The thermal stability of quality resin systems ensures consistent performance across temperature ranges typical in the UK. Unlike some materials that become brittle in cold conditions or soften excessively in heat, properly formulated resins maintain their structural integrity year-round. This stability translates to reduced cracking, minimal expansion issues, and consistent appearance regardless of seasonal weather variations.
Professional Installation of Resin Outdoor Flooring
Successful resin flooring installation requires careful preparation and specialised knowledge of local climate conditions. Professional installers assess substrate conditions, ensuring proper drainage and addressing any existing moisture issues before application. The installation process typically involves surface preparation, primer application, and multiple resin layers applied under controlled conditions to achieve optimal adhesion and performance.
Timing plays a crucial role in resin installation success. Experienced contractors schedule work during suitable weather windows, avoiding periods of high humidity, extreme temperatures, or precipitation. Proper curing conditions ensure the resin achieves its full strength and weather resistance properties. Professional installation also includes appropriate surface texturing to maintain slip resistance and aesthetic appeal.
Easy Maintenance Tips to Extend Resin Flooring Life
Resin surfaces require minimal maintenance compared to traditional outdoor flooring options, but simple care routines significantly extend their lifespan. Regular cleaning with mild detergents removes organic matter that could stain or degrade the surface over time. Pressure washing at moderate settings effectively removes accumulated debris without damaging the resin finish.
Seasonal maintenance includes checking for any minor damage and addressing issues promptly before they expand. Autumn leaf removal prevents staining and maintains surface appearance, while winter preparations may include ensuring proper drainage to prevent ice formation. Annual inspections by professionals can identify potential issues early, allowing for cost-effective repairs rather than extensive renovations.
Environmental Advantages of Sustainable Resin Systems
Modern resin formulations increasingly incorporate sustainable materials and manufacturing processes, reducing their environmental impact compared to traditional surfacing options. Many systems use recycled aggregates and low-emission formulations that contribute to healthier outdoor environments. The longevity of resin surfaces reduces replacement frequency, minimising waste generation and resource consumption over time.
Permeable resin options support sustainable drainage systems (SuDS) requirements, allowing rainwater to filter through the surface rather than creating runoff. This characteristic helps manage surface water in compliance with UK planning regulations while reducing strain on local drainage infrastructure. The reduced need for replacement and maintenance activities also decreases the carbon footprint associated with ongoing surface management.
